The MAX8550/MAX8551 integrate a synchronous-buck PWM controller to generate VDDQ, a sourcing and sinking LDO linear regulator to generate VTT, and a 10mA reference output buffer to generate VTTR. The buck controller drives two external N-channel MOSFETs to generate output voltages down to 0.7V from a 2V to 28V input with output currents up to 15A. The LDO can sink or source up to 1.5A continuous and 3A peak current. Both the LDO output and the 10mA reference buffer output can be made to track the REFIN voltage. These features make the MAX8550/MAX8551 ideally suited for DDR memory applications in desktops, notebooks, and graphic cards.

The PWM controller in the MAX8550/MAX8551 utilizes Maxim's proprietary Quick-PWM architecture with programmable switching frequencies of up to 600kHz. This control scheme handles wide input/output voltage ratios with ease and provides 100ns response to load transients while maintaining high efficiency and a relatively constant switching frequency. The MAX8550 offers fully programmable UVP/OVP and skip-mode options ideal in portable applications. Skip mode allows for improved efficiency at lighter loads. The MAX8551, which is targeted towards desktop and graphic-card applications, does not offer the pulse-skip feature.

The VTT and VTTR outputs track to within 1% of VREFIN/2. The high bandwidth of this LDO regulator allows excellent transient response without the need for bulk capacitors, thus reducing cost and size.

The buck controller and LDO regulators are provided with independent current limits. Adjustable lossless foldback current limit for the buck regulator is achieved by monitoring the drain-to-source voltage drop of the low-side MOSFET. Additionally, overvoltage and undervoltage protection mechanisms are built in. Once the overcurrent condition is removed, the regulator is allowed to enter soft-start again. This helps minimize power dissipation during a short-circuit condition. The MAX8550/MAX8551 allow flexible sequencing and standby power management using the active-low SHDNA, active-low SHDNB, and STBY inputs.

Both the MAX8550 and MAX8551 are available in a small 5mm x 5mm, 28-pin thin QFN package.

    The MAX8550 evaluation kit (EV kit) is designed to evaluate the MAX8550 DDR power-supply solution for notebooks, desktops, and graphics cards. The EV kit board produces VDDQ at the output of the synchronous PWM buck, VTT at the output of the sourcing/sinking LDO linear regulator, and VTTR at the output of the reference buffer.

    The VDDQ output is preset to 2.5V and sources up to 12A. The VTT output is always VDDQ/2 and can source/sink up to 3A of peak current and 1.5A of continuous current. The VTTR output is also always VDDQ/2 and can source/sink up to 10mA.

    The MAX8550 EV kit was conveniently designed with jumpers to select the OVP/UVP, TON, SKIP-bar, STBY, and SHDN_-bar modes. The board's default settings enable OVP (overvoltage protection), 600kHz switching frequency, low-noise PWM mode, VDDQ, VTT, and VTTR.

    The VIN input accepts voltages from 9V to 20V and VDD requires a 5V bias supply.

    The EV kit comes with the MAX8550 installed. Contact the factory for free samples of the MAX8550A or MAX8551 to evaluate these parts.
